Brother seeks answers after California festival attendee dies from brain injury
David Granado Jr. died following a severe brain injury sustained at the Warped Tour in Long Beach, prompting his brother Alejandro to demand information from organizers.
At the Warped Tour event in Long Beach on July 26, concertgoer David Granado Jr. split from his brother Alejandro to view separate performances. Roughly ninety minutes later, David arrived at a medical tent on his own and was subsequently transported to a local emergency room around 8:19 p.m. Medical staff identified a severe brain injury and performed several surgeries, but the circumstances leading to the injury have not been confirmed.
Alejandro reports that the festival has not responded to his inquiries and that his brother's emergency contact was not informed after the medical tent visit or hospital transfer. He has publicly asked for witnesses or information to clarify what happened. As of Friday evening, festival organizers had not released any comment on the incident.
